DisneyWorld Resort Update

February 28, 2019

Disney World has announced plans for a new nature-inspired resort.  Situated on Bay Lake, between Disney’s Wilderness Lodge and Disney’s Fort Wilderness Resort & Campground, the new resort will offer 900 guestrooms, in addition to Disney Vacation Club Villas.  This newly announced resort, which has not yet been named, is expected to debut in 2022.  The theme park complex opens another new Disney Vacation Club Villas resort at the end of this year.  Disney’s Riviera Resort will celebrate the grandeur of Europe—which has long inspired some of the greatest Disney stories with its castles and fairy-tale villages.  It will also have an onsite station for the Disney Skyliner, the new gondola lift system that will connect several resorts to Hollywood Studios and EPCOT!
